What Features Make a Hair Clipper Quiet?
The features that contribute to making a hair clipper quiet include:
- Motor Type: Clippers with a rotary motor are generally quieter than those with magnetic or pivot motors. Rotary motors operate at a consistent speed and produce less vibration, resulting in a smoother and quieter cutting experience.
- Blade Design: The design and material of the blades can impact noise levels. Blades made from high-quality stainless steel and those with precision grinding tend to make less noise while cutting, as they operate more efficiently and reduce friction.
- Sound Dampening Technology: Some clippers incorporate sound-dampening materials or designs that absorb vibrations and reduce noise. These technologies can significantly lower the decibel levels of operation, making the clipper much quieter during use.
- Weight and Balance: A well-balanced clipper that is lightweight can minimize noise. Heavier clippers may produce more vibrations and noise, while a balanced design reduces strain on the motor and allows for quieter operation.
- Speed Settings: Clippers with adjustable speed settings can be quieter at lower speeds. This allows users to select a speed that minimizes noise while still achieving an effective cut, making them ideal for sensitive individuals.
- Maintenance: Regular maintenance, such as oiling the blades and cleaning the clipper, can prevent noise issues. A well-maintained clipper operates more smoothly and quietly, as dirt and debris can increase friction and sound levels during use.

How Can You Ensure Longevity in Your Quiet Hair Clipper?
To ensure longevity in your quiet hair clipper, consider the following best practices:
- Regular Cleaning: Keeping your clipper clean is essential to its performance and lifespan. Hair and debris can accumulate in the blades and motor, leading to overheating and reduced efficiency, so clean it after every use using a brush and, occasionally, a damp cloth.
- Proper Lubrication: Lubricating the blades helps to reduce friction and heat during use, which can prolong the life of the clipper. Use clipper oil recommended by the manufacturer and apply it regularly to keep the blades operating smoothly.
- Avoiding Overuse: Like any electronic device, hair clippers have limits. Overusing your clipper without allowing it to rest can cause overheating and wear down the motor; therefore, it’s wise to give your clipper breaks during longer grooming sessions.
- Storing Correctly: Storing your clipper properly can prevent damage to the blades and motor. Use a case or pouch to protect it from dust and impacts, and ensure that the blades are covered to avoid dulling when not in use.
- Using the Right Power Source: If your clipper is corded, ensure that you are using it with the correct voltage. For cordless models, keep the battery charged according to the manufacturer’s instructions, as frequent deep discharges can reduce battery lifespan.
What Maintenance Tips Can Help Reduce Noise Over Time?
To maintain a quiet hair clipper and reduce noise over time, consider the following t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Keeping the clipper clean is essential for reducing noise. Hair and debris can accumulate in the blades and motor, causing friction that leads to increased noise levels. Regularly remove hair clippings and clean the blades with a brush, and occasionally rinse them under water if they are waterproof.
- Lubrication: Applying oil to the blades can significantly decrease noise. Proper lubrication minimizes friction between the moving parts, ensuring smoother operation and quieter performance. Use the manufacturer-recommended oil and apply it according to the instructions to keep the clipper running quietly.
- Blade Alignment: Misaligned blades can create additional noise during operation. Ensure that the blades are properly aligned and securely fastened, as this can prevent unnecessary rattling and vibrations that contribute to noise. Regularly check and adjust the alignment as needed to maintain optimal performance.
- Battery Maintenance: For cordless hair clippers, maintaining the battery is crucial for noise reduction. A weak or failing battery can cause the motor to strain, resulting in increased noise. Regularly charge the battery and replace it if you notice a decrease in performance or if it no longer holds a charge effectively.
- Storage and Handling: Proper storage and handling of the clipper can also influence its noise levels. Store the clipper in a protective case or pouch to avoid damage, and handle it with care to prevent misalignment of parts. Avoid dropping or jarring the clipper, as this can lead to mechanical issues that may increase noise during operation.
